IMPORTANT SAFETY INFORMATION Intended uses The pump is designed and constructed for incorporation in plants and machinery (spraying machines for the protective treatment of agricultural crops and garden plants). All other uses constitute misuse unless ap- proved by the manufacturer's technical service The pump must be used in a manner appropriate to its technical data (see “Technical Data”), and must not be modified or improperly used.
Installation • The crankshaft may turn in either direction. • The water connection with the pump must be made using hoses of suitable diameter, in all case no less than that of the pump fittings, securing them to the fittings using good quality clamps. The intake hose must be coil-reinforced to prevent restrictions.

INSTALLATION INSTRUCTIONS General guidelines on water supply connection To operate correctly, the diaphragm pump must draw in liquids from containers at atmospheric pressure. Do not supply the pump with pressurised liquids. For continuous duty, the pump should not draw in water by gravity from containers with liquid level at heights above 3 m.

Safety recommendations for maintenance Before doing any maintenance work, depressurise the water system and isolate the pump from all en- ergy sources. When the jobs are done, before restarting the pump, check that no tools, rags or other materials have been left close to moving parts or in hazardous zones.
MAINTENANCE INSTRUCTIONS Table of lubricants The pump is delivered complete with high-performance 30 weight, non-detergent oil suitable for the intended ambient conditions (see "Environmental operating limits"). Inspecting the pump mounting Check that the pump's fixing screws have not become loose. If necessary, tighten them with the driving torque stated in the installation design.

Pump Storage It is important to comply with the recommendations for storage in the operator's manual of the machine into which the pump is incorporated. For the pump itself, at the end of pumping operations it is essential to flush out the internal circuit by pump ing clean water.
TROUBLESHOOTING The information provided is intended to provide guidance how to deal with malfunctions which may occur during use. Some of these procedures may be carried out by skilled staff, while others have to be performed at specialised service centres since they require the use of specific equipment as well as detailed knowledge of repair opera tions.
